Control Arm: Description and Operation





DESCRIPTION






NOTE: The tension links (5) are left/right specific but could be installed incorrectly. Be sure that the bushing bevel is located at and against the knuckle.

The tension link (5) is connected between the cradle and the front of the knuckle with a bonded bushing on each end. The bushings are serviced with a new link only. On the knuckle side of the link, the bushing is not between two parts of a bracket. Because of this the bolt (4) has a captive washer that will hold the bushing/link in place if the bonding were to separate from the link. Make sure that the proper bolts and nuts are used when servicing.





The bushing (2) on the knuckle side of the link (3) has a beveled edge (1) on one side. The link (3) must be installed so that the beveled edge (1) contacts and seats within the recessed area of the knuckle.
